Tools (7)

ctrl_get_vault_status
Read the user's CTRL vault address, ETH + WETH balance, and active rules. Call this BEFORE ctrl_activate so you can tell the user how much they need to fund.
ctrl_get_block_catalog

ctrl_create_workflow
Create a CTRL workflow draft. ONE trigger + an ordered chain of up to 20 actions/conditions/utilities. Returns { workflowId, activateUrl }. ctrl_activate
Return an EIP-5792 transactions[] batch the user signs ONCE to deploy their vault + register spending rules. After signing, the keeper runs the workflow autonomously per the on-chain caps.
ctrl_withdraw
Return an EIP-5792 batch the user signs to withdraw funds from their CTRL vault back to their wallet. The agent never signs. token defaults to ETH; pass WETH or a 0x token address for other assets; omit amount to withdraw the full balance.
ctrl_fire_manual
Manually fire a workflow once. Keeper picks up within ~5s. Use to test a workflow without waiting for its natural trigger.
ctrl_get_execution_logs
Read recent workflow executions: trigger, status, BaseScan tx hash, gas, timing. Without workflowId returns the user's most recent across all workflows.

What this means. This server responded to the MCP handshake and listed its tools without authentication. The schema fingerprint lets us flag if tool signatures silently change (schema drift) between checks.
